(ROCHESTER, MI) – July 02, 2010 — Rochester Mills Beer Co. announces the first local distribution from its lineup of handcrafted ales and lagers to the greater Metro-Detroit area.
After 12 years of brewing quality beers at its downtown brewpub in Rochester, Michigan, the Rochester Mills Beer Co. is making its popular India Pale Ale, aptly named Cornerstone IPA, available for the first time on tap and in 6-pks (Full Pint 16 oz. cans) according to Pleszure Food Group Marketing Director, David Youngman. The beer will be brewed under contract by Millking it Productions in Royal Oak, Michigan.
“If you consider yourself a “hophead”, this one’s for you.”, says Rochester Mills Beer Co.’s Head Brewer Eric Briggeman, who oversees the brewing of Cornerstone IPA at Millking it Productions to ensure its consistency. “Cornerstone IPA is an unfiltered, amber-colored ale packed with hop bitterness, flavor and aroma. Dry hopped with Centennial hops for lots of flavor and a citrusy aromatic finish.”
Rochester Mills elected to bring Cornerstone IPA to the market in cans for a number of compelling reasons. Aluminum cans keep beer fresher for longer by fully eliminating the damages of light and exposure to oxygen that happen in bottled beers. Highly portable and virtually unbreakable, cans enable craft beer lovers to easily enjoy great beer in places where glass bottles are not welcome or allowed: the beach, pool, boat, trail, river, tub, golf course, backpack and many others. You can imagine the possibilities.
Aluminum cans also distinguish themselves as the most recycled and most recyclable beverage container in the world, with more than 100,000 cans recycled every minute nationwide. Recycling aluminum cans saves 95% of the energy used to make cans from virgin ore. We currently have enough aluminum in circulation to maintain production levels indefinitely if everyone recycled.
When asked Why 16 oz. cans? Briggeman responded, “We wanted to give you a full pint, just like we do at the brewpub.”

ABOUT ROCHESTER MILLS BEER CO.
The Rochester Mills Beer Co. opened in 1998 in Downtown Rochester. The anchor business inside the restored historic Western Knitting Mill, the brewery is located on Water Street, just two blocks east of Main Street. Preserving the original character of the building, the brewery features original hardwood floors, columns, beams and exposed brick walls of the mill.
